Mardan district nazim, others booked for manhandling official
MARDAN: The police have registered a case against several elected representatives of local government, including district nazim, for allegedly manhandling the assistant director of the Local Government and Rural Development.
Sources added that Assistant Director Fazlullah submitted an application with the Saddar Police Station, accusing District Nazim Himayatullah Mayar of making threats against him. He said in his application that District Nazim Himayatullah Mayar told him in a phone call that he had issued an execute order to open the office of neighborhood council, Bagh-e-Ram. He alleged the district nazim used harsh words while talking to him on the phone.
The official said that later he was attending a meeting at his office when Himayatullah Mayar along with neighborhood council, Bagh-e-Ram, naib nazim Syed Murtaza Shah Bacha, general councillors Akhtar Zaman, Inamullah, Qadir Khan and others reached there. He alleged that they made threats against him and roughed him up.
The police registered a case against the accused under relevant sections of the law. It may be noted that the Awami National Party formed the district government in Mardan as it won several seats in the local government election that were held on May 31, 2015.
